 "MoonLight Muse Paradise"
Sand castles with hand dug moats, crashing waves and sailing boats. Walking bare foot on sandy shores, collecting sea shells, all shapes and sorts. As I watch the ebb and flow of the tide, I feel a release and comfort inside. Calming and peaceful my senses alive, I've been waiting too long for this day to arrive I'm front row center stage with an awesome view, watching the ocean touch the sky so blue. A soothing symphony played out in time, as the waves crash on the rocks at my side.

I smell the salt in the mist of the breeze, as each tide laps at the edge of the beach. This is paradise to my aching soul, therapy unlike any that I've ever known. I run my fingers through the soft silky sand, feeling the texture sift through my hand. I'm not day dreaming...I'm really here, a place in the sun I've dreamt of for years. My troubles are gone, washed out to sea, I'm not taking any of them back with me. I feel as though I've come alive, My weary soul has been revived.
Original poetry © 2001 Arona Sims
